ComFish Alaska Scheduled for April 15-17, 2025
Kodiak is gearing up for the arrival of hundreds of visitors for the annual ComFish Alaska Expo and Fisheries Forums Tuesday, April 15th through Thursday 17th at Kodiak Marketplace. ComFish is the largest and longest-running fisheries trade show in Alaska. Kodiak is home to a diverse commercial fishing fleet, with more than 700 vessels homeported at its two harbors. Kodiak consistently ranks in the top 10 U.S. fishing ports for seafood landings and value.
In its 47th year of service to the fishing industry, ComFish Alaska continues to adapt to the changing face of fisheries technology, markets, and regulatory actions. ComFish provides a unique opportunity for people to bring their goods and services directly to where people in the fishing industry live and work and serves as a one- stop shop for stakeholders to get the latest information about seafood industry issues. The Alaska Fishery Policy Forum has become the platform during which harvesters, processors, community leaders, industry members, and policy makers can discuss specific issues related to Alaska’s commercial fisheries. This year’s Forums draw state and federal authorities, community leaders, and many others together for important fisheries discussions including US Senator Lisa Murkowski, Congressman Nick Begich, ADF&G Commissioner Doug Vincent-Lang, Dr. Bob Foy, NOAA, Senator Gary Stevens, and Representative Louise Stutes.
